Job Summary

You will be working player check-in at our showcase on Saturday and Sunday, 1/10-1/11 at The Barn in Menasha, WI.  As a check-in staff member, you will be the first person players, parents, coaches, and spectators see when they enter the venue. You will receive a complimentary staff shirt to wear at the event. The hours will be roughly 8:00am-10:00pm Saturday, and 8:00am-6:00pm Sunday. You will be paid $15/hour via direct deposit. Payment is generally sent Monday following the event.

Responsibilities and Duties

First responsibilities:

  • Checking wristbands and ensuring no spectator is getting in without paying
  • If any spectator tries to enter without you seeing their wristband, you must call them out to show their wristband
  • If any spectator tries to enter wearing the incorrect color wristband, you must call them out
  • The only people that can enter without wearing a wristband are players, officials, event staff, and Prep Network staff
Secondary responsibilities may include:
  • Assisting with team check-in
  • Assisting with admissions and/or troubleshooting POS devices
  • Checking for other entrances or doors being propped open where spectators could be getting in without paying
  • If necessary, work clock/book for a game if a team doesn’t have a parent to work it
  • Retrieving scoresheets after games are complete
  • Assisting with event clean-up
  • Any other tasks the event director may ask of you
